Output d118ca72757556dc352b224f9b002f10f2e3d9da3c89169831a10dc7eb91ce95:1

value
12476791
script pubkey
OP_0 OP_PUSHBYTES_20 0353c568f0de29f75970854bf5f8aac8c85367e8
address
bc1qqdfu268smc5lwktss49lt792ery9xelg62wqrj
transaction
d118ca72757556dc352b224f9b002f10f2e3d9da3c89169831a10dc7eb91ce95
confirmations
104162
spent
true